Nobody knows what they're doing. Nobody does. Everyone's winging it out there. Some people are just better at pretending to be confident.
Kumail Nanjiani
Grinnell College Commencement 2017, 2017

Kumail Nanjiani, the Pakistani-American comedian and star of The Big Sick, returned to Grinnell College — the small Iowa liberal arts school where he'd arrived twenty years earlier unable to identify a hacky sack — to deliver the 2017 commencement address. In a speech that moved deftly between comedy and genuine emotion, he shared this reassuring truth with the graduates facing the 'gaping maw of uncertainty.' When he was a kid, he thought his parents were superheroes who knew everything and were already the people they would always be. As an adult, he realized they had the same struggles everyone does — they'd uprooted their lives and moved to America in their fifties, starting over. Nobody is finished becoming who they are.
